| Descripció: | Physical layer impairments accumulate as light propagates through a lightpath in the transparent optical networks. Therefore, it is possible to provision a lightpath, while its quality of transmission (QoT) does not meet the required threshold. Considering
the physical layer impairments in the network planning phase gives rise to a set of offline Impairments Aware Routing and
Wavelength Assignment (IA-RWA) algorithms. There are very few offline IA-RWA algorithms that consider dedicated path protection demands. In this work we propose a novel offline IA-RWA algorithm, called Rahyab and perform a comparative performance evaluation study, which considers two enhanced algorithms from the literature. Simulation results indicates that demand pre-processing,
diverse routing, and adaptive wavelength assignment are the main reasons of lower blocking rate of Rahyab algorithm compared
to the selected algorithms. |
